Within the sacred texts of Hinduism lies a powerful narrative known as the Devi Mahatmyam. This ancient tale recounts the triumphant deeds of the Goddess, Shakti, and her fearsome battle against malevolent forces.
Through vivid illustrations, the Devi Mahatmyam showcases the Goddess's divine strength. She is celebrated as the guardian of faithful souls, vanquishing evil with her impenetrable courage. Her triumph serves as a inspiration for all who strive for ethical enlightenment.
The Devi Mahatmyam is not merely a {mythologicalnarrative, but a profound meditation on the character of the divine feminine. It inspires devotees to develop their own inner strength, reminding them that even in the face of hardship, the Goddess's protection is always near.

Durga Chalisa: A Chant for Strength and Safety
The Durga Chalisa is a beloved Hindu devotional hymn chanted in praise of Goddess Durga, the divine protector and vanquisher of evil. Grateful Hindus often chant this get more info powerful text to seek her favor for strength, protection, and prosperity. The Chalisa's melodious verses illuminate Durga's magnificent power, invoking her to remove obstacles and provide peace in their lives.
- Several believe that regular chanting of the Durga Chalisa can strengthen the soul and attract Goddess Durga's presence, bringing joy and prosperity.
- Additionally, it is considered a powerful incantation to ward off negative energies and dark entities.
Whether sung for personal growth, protection, or simply to honor the divine feminine, the Durga Chalisa remains a inspiring hymn that touches the hearts of millions.
